In my opinion, you may have trouble playing some of these games. Even though a particular system (laptop or desktop), does meet the required minimum/recommended settings, does not often mean it will run or run smoothly. Such games require dedicated graphics cards that you can purchase for desktops, additional memory, additional power, etc. and additional hardware requirements.
There are laptops currently in the market that are capable of playing these demanding games at a decent game setting, but will be quite expensive on the wallet to purchase.
However, you might be able to play a couple of old school shooters, majority of the action oriented strategy games (probably not Supreme Commander or Total Annihilation series... reason, I had specs that was well over recommended suggestion for a PC, and filled the entire map with over 1000+ units, suffice to say my system lagged), certain MMOs, and yes Angry Bird...
